#83f3b4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#83f3b4 is composed of 51.4% red, 95.3%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.9%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 146.3 degrees, a saturation of 82.4% and a lightness of 73.3%. #83f3b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#07e769. Closest websafe color is: #99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#83f3b4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#eefd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#83f3b4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b7bfbb is the less saturated color, while #79fdb3 is the most saturated one.
